GRANDMA B'S WHOLE WHEAT FLAT BREAD | |
1 qt. cold water 1 qt. scalded milk 3 pkgs. yeast 6 tsp. salt 1 c. honey 3 full c. whole wheat flour 3 c. white flour 1 c. fat, melted (not hot) Mix well with spoon. Add enough white flour to make dough slightly sticky. Knead a little. Let it rise double in size. Punch down and rise dough again. Divide into 6 round loaves. Let rise a little. Take loaves and stretch into oblong flats. (1 pair per cookie sheet about 1 to 1 1/4 inches thick.) Prick with butt end of butter knife. Let rise 10 to 15 minutes. Bake 30 minutes at 375 degrees. Makes 6 large loaves. Excellent warm. Freeze the rest to have on hand for later use. |
